Meall Chuaich Walk
The Meall Chuaich Walk is an exceptional adventure on the edge of Cairngorms National Park that will take you uphill for breathtaking views of the surrounding landscape. While out walking the trail, you will make your way along Allt Cuaich and pass by the shores of Loch Cuaich to reach the summit of Meall Chuaich, where you will have an amazing sightline across the park. Although there is a fair bit of elevation gain, this is a wonderful adventure that is well-suited to both casual and seasoned walkers.

Route Description for Meall Chuaich Walk
For those visitors to Cairngorms National Park that walk to experience a bit of a leg burn accompanied by stunning views across the rugged landscape of the surrounding area, then the Meall Chuaich Walk will definitely meet all of your needs.
Setting out from the trailhead, you will make your way east alongside a winding road that runs parallel to Allt Cuaich and takes you in the direction of your objective of the day, the summit of Meall Chuaich. After passing by the charming shores of Loch Cuaich, you will arrive at the base of the hill, which is a great place to pause before making the relatively steep ascent.
Continuing on to the northeast, you will climb up the rugged slopes of Meall Chuaich and gain a better perspective of the surrounding landscape, which will culminate in sweeping views from the summit. Once you have taken in the breathtaking scenery of Cairngorms NP, you will head back down the same trail on the return to your vehicle below.
Getting to the Meall Chuaich Walk Trailhead
The trailhead for the Meall Chuaich Walk can be found at a roadside layby along A(, just 4.3 km northeast of Dalwhinnie.
